What does it mean to be spiritually reborn?

Being spiritually reborn means being born of God, receiving a new nature that aligns with God's Word and character.

Spiritual rebirth is foundational to the Christian faith, as described in John 1:12-13, where those who receive Christ are given the right to become children of God. This rebirth is not through human effort or lineage but from God Himself. 1 John 3:9 emphasizes that whoever is born of God does not sin because God's seed remains in them; they cannot sin. This does not imply perfection but rather a new inclination to pursue righteousness and understand God's truth. Being reborn transforms one's nature, enabling them to respond to God's Word with faith and obedience.
Scripture References: John 1:12-13, 1 John 3:9
